Club legend Ross Hannah's pens message to fans following departure

As noted on social media this evening, Gladiators fan favourite and legend has decided to depart the club due to family and work commitments. Ross wished to pen a short open letter to the Gladiators fan base on his departure which can be found below.

--------

Firstly I would like to thank the gaffer for bringing me back to the club that I’ll always be very fond of and a club that allowed me the opportunity to forge a career in professional football, winning the Non League Golden Boot at the time was a real highlight of my first spell. Unfortunately last season when it eventually started, didn’t finish how we all wanted it too but how I see the club now to the club I left in 2012 is very different and has a very positive future. A club doing all the right things and going in the right direction. Jase being appointed as the new chairman in my eyes is a master stroke and will continue the great work already done by Bryn and the board. Along with the great support of the fans old & new, the management, the lads that are staying with the new additions added already will give them a great chance of competing at the very top of the league again next season.

As I always have, I will be supporting the club from a distance. I’ll be checking the results and following the progress which they’ll continue to make.

Just to be clear the gaffer and the club wanted me to stay and made it clear what they think of me which I appreciate a lot but with me not getting any younger, having a young family and working unsociable hours I feel playing a bit more closer to home with less travel to away games etc is the right thing to be looking to do for me and my family.

Lastly I would like to thank every single person involved at the club, too many to mention individually but the work everyone puts in all around the club doesn’t go unnoticed and the lads always appreciate everything you do.

My family always enjoyed coming to Matlock and always felt welcomed, we really appreciate that so thank you. Keep doing what you do everyone, I know you will

Take care all, enjoy the break even though it’s not long before we’re all back at it. I wish you all the best for next season and for the future.

UTG!

Ross Hannah.
